I am currently a lvl 55 balance wizard. I had chosen storm to be my secondary school. I realized by lvl 45 that this was a mistake. I can barely ever use the spells and they fizzle so often. To buy all of my training points back it is going to cost 4,900 crowns! That's almost ten dollars. I know the game is a business but i think that is an outrageous price. There should be another way to get them back.

This is the discussion of Time vs Crowns.

You can either spend the Time to create a new character with new secondary spells or you can spend the Crowns to reset those spells on your current character.

The more Training points you have spent, the more Crowns are required to get them back, or the more time it would take to earn them on a new character.

This issue has been brought up in the past. KI has given us free stuff in the past but this is not going to be one of them..... This is one of those areas where we learn by out mistakes.

A few days ago I bought back all the training points for 4 of my wizards. 2 of those wizards were Legendaries and the buy back for just those 2 was over 11,500 crowns total. The other 2 totaled 4,800.

As Professor Greyrose said, you can start a new wizard.

If you want to start a new one in your current school, I would suggest you do so before deleting the one you have so you can transfer everything to the new one. You can trade anything that does not tell you NO TRADE.
